Locating the Fuse Boxes in Your 2012 Honda Accord
Knowing the precise locations of your Accord’s fuse boxes is a fundamental aspect of effective electrical system maintenance. Most 2012 Honda Accord models feature at least two primary fuse boxes, meticulously placed to manage different segments of the vehicle’s extensive electrical network.
1. The Under-Hood Fuse Box (Engine Compartment Fuse/Relay Box)
This critical fuse box is typically situated in the engine compartment, usually on the driver’s side. It’s often found near the vehicle’s battery or engine, clearly marked with a plastic cover. This box houses fuses and relays for high-current circuits, including the engine control systems, headlights, cooling fans, and crucial powertrain components.
To access it, simply unclip the retaining tabs or clips on the fuse box cover and lift it off. The underside of this cover frequently contains a diagram of the fuses within, providing immediate, trusted reference.
2. The Interior Fuse Box
The interior fuse box, sometimes referred to as the dashboard fuse box, manages circuits for cabin electronics and accessories. In your 2012 Honda Accord, this box is most commonly located under the dashboard on the driver’s side, often positioned in the footwell area or behind an access panel near the OBD-II port. Its placement allows for convenient access while minimizing its visual impact on the cabin aesthetics.

Step-by-Step Guide: Accessing Your Interior Fuse Box
Sit in the driver’s seat and look towards the lower left side of the dashboard, often around knee level or below the steering column. You might need to adjust your seat backward and use a flashlight for better visibility.
The interior fuse box is typically concealed behind a small plastic access panel, often rectangular and approximately 4-6 inches wide. This panel might have a small indentation or slot for prying.
Use a trim removal tool or a flat-head screwdriver wrapped in tape (to prevent scratches) to gently pry off the panel. It’s usually held in place by friction clips. Pull it off carefully to avoid damaging the clips or the surrounding trim, ensuring a professional approach. The back of this panel often also features a fuse diagram.
While some vehicles might have auxiliary fuse locations for specific components in areas like the trunk or under seats, the 2012 Honda Accord typically relies on these two primary fuse boxes for most circuits. Always cross-reference with your vehicle’s owner’s manual for model-specific variations and the most trusted and complete information, as precise locations can sometimes vary slightly by trim level or market.

Diagnosing Electrical Faults and Testing Fuses in Your 2012 Accord
When an electrical component in your 2012 Honda Accord ceases to function, a blown fuse is often the simplest and most common culprit. A systematic and reliable diagnostic process is crucial to confirm this and avoid unnecessary component replacements.
📋
Step-by-Step Guide: Diagnosing a Blown Fuse
Note the precise electrical malfunction. For example, if your headlights are not working, but the parking lights are, it narrows down the issue. Common symptoms pointing to a blown fuse include specific lights not working, power outlets being dead, the radio remaining silent, or power windows becoming inoperative.
Consult your 2012 Honda Accord’s fuse box diagram (from the cover or owner’s manual) to find the fuse associated with the faulty component. For the headlight example, you would look for the ‘HEADLIGHT’ or ‘HI BEAM’ fuse in the under-hood fuse box.
There are several ways to test a fuse. A visual inspection involves carefully removing the fuse and looking for a broken or melted filament. However, visual inspection is only about 70-80% reliable, especially for smaller, opaque fuses. For a more accurate test, use a multimeter set to continuity mode (ohms). A properly functioning fuse will show continuity (zero or near-zero ohms) across its terminals. If it shows an open circuit (OL or infinite resistance), the fuse is blown. Alternatively, a dedicated fuse tester provides a quick, clear indication.
If the fuse tests good, the problem lies elsewhere. This requires ruling out other potential electrical issues such as faulty relays (often found alongside fuses in the under-hood box), loose connections, or the failure of the component itself (e.g., a burnt-out headlight bulb). A scenario where headlights aren’t working would involve checking the fuse, then the relay, and finally the bulb, to ensure a complete and expert diagnosis.
Before working on any electrical components, always ensure the vehicle is off. For more extensive diagnostics or if you are uncomfortable, it’s prudent to disconnect the negative terminal of the battery to prevent accidental shorts or electrical shocks, ensuring a professional and safe operation.
Safe and Professional Fuse Replacement Procedures for the 2012 Accord
Once a blown fuse has been identified, proper replacement is critical to restore functionality and prevent further electrical problems. This isn’t merely a matter of swapping components; it demands adherence to best practices to ensure the long-term reliability and safety of your 2012 Honda Accord’s electrical system.
Necessary Tools and Preparation
Before you begin, gather the essential tools: a fuse puller (often conveniently located clipped inside one of the fuse box covers), a flashlight for clear visibility, and most importantly, appropriate replacement fuses. Ensure the vehicle’s ignition is off, and consider disconnecting the battery’s negative terminal for added safety.
📋
Step-by-Step Guide: Fuse Replacement
Use the fuse puller to grip the blown fuse firmly and pull it straight out from its slot. Exercise careful handling to avoid bending or damaging the fuse box terminals. These terminals are delicate and damage can lead to intermittent electrical issues.
This step is paramount: always replace a blown fuse with a new fuse of the exact same amperage rating and type as specified in the diagram or as the original fuse you removed. If the original was a 10A mini-blade fuse, use a 10A mini-blade replacement. Modern vehicle fuses, such as those in your Accord, are specifically designed to fail as a sacrificial component, often rated with a 125% safety margin above typical operating current to handle momentary surges.
Align the new fuse with the empty slot and push it firmly into place until it seats completely. You should feel a slight click as it locks in.
Reconnect the battery if you disconnected it, then turn on the ignition and test the affected electrical component. If it works, securely replace the fuse box cover and any access panels. If the fuse blows again immediately, a deeper electrical issue exists that requires professional investigation.
Never, under any circumstances, replace a fuse with one of a higher amperage rating or attempt to bypass it with metal foil or wire. For instance, replacing a 10A fuse with a 20A fuse could allow excessive current to flow, leading to severe wiring damage, overheating, and potentially a vehicle fire. Conversely, using a lower amperage fuse will likely result in repeated blowing, indicating that the circuit cannot sustain its normal operating load. Always source quality, authentic replacement fuses that meet Honda’s specifications for optimal performance and safety.

Preventative Inspections and Practices
- Periodic Fuse Box Checks: Make it a habit to periodically inspect both under-hood and interior fuse boxes. Look for any signs of corrosion on fuse terminals, which can increase resistance and lead to localized heat build-up. Also, check for loose connections or any discoloration (e.g., melted plastic around a fuse), which indicates overheating and a potential underlying issue.
- Address Repeatedly Blown Fuses: If a fuse for a specific accessory or component blows repeatedly, this is a clear indicator of a deeper electrical issue. Simply replacing it will not resolve the problem. Such persistence signals a short circuit, an overloaded circuit, or a faulty component that requires professional diagnosis. For example, a continuously blowing fuse for a specific accessory suggests checking the accessory’s wiring or the component itself.
- Proper Aftermarket Accessory Installation: One of the most common causes of electrical issues stems from improper aftermarket installations. When adding accessories like new head units, auxiliary lights, or charging ports, ensure they are installed with dedicated wiring harnesses, correctly sized wires, and appropriate fuses. Avoid “piggybacking” off existing circuits, as this can easily overload them and lead to fuse problems or even more severe damage.
- Carry a Spare Fuse Kit: Always keep a small assortment of common amperage fuses (e.g., 10A, 15A, 20A) in your vehicle. This trusted preparedness can be invaluable for roadside emergencies, allowing you to quickly replace a blown fuse and restore functionality without being stranded.

Frequently Asked Questions
Why do fuses blow in a 2012 Honda Accord?
Fuses primarily blow to protect circuits from overcurrent. This typically occurs due to a short circuit, an overloaded circuit (e.g., too many accessories on one power source), or a faulty component drawing excessive current. It’s a critical safety mechanism preventing wiring damage or potential fire hazards, highlighting the robust, reliable design of your vehicle’s electrical safeguards.
Can I use a higher amperage fuse in my 2012 Accord?
No, absolutely not. Replacing a blown fuse with one of a higher amperage rating is extremely dangerous. It bypasses the circuit’s intended protection, allowing excessive current to flow. This can severely damage wiring, costly electrical components, or even cause an electrical fire. Always use a fuse with the exact specified amperage for quality, reliable protection.
How do I know if a fuse is blown without removing it?
For some blade fuses, a visual inspection reveals a broken or burnt filament inside. However, this isn’t always clear, especially for smaller fuses. The most accurate professional method is using a fuse tester or a multimeter set to continuity mode. Insert the probes onto the test points on top of the fuse; a lack of continuity or a ‘no light’ indication confirms it’s blown, ensuring trusted results.
Where is the fuse puller located in my 2012 Honda Accord?
A small, plastic fuse puller tool is typically located within one of your Accord’s fuse boxes. It’s most commonly found clipped to the inside of the under-hood fuse box cover, or sometimes within the interior fuse box.
